Workout and Stretching Strategies



To avoid injuries during fighting styles training, it's essential to properly warm up your body and carry out efficient extending methods.

Before diving right into intense physical activity, take a couple of mins to get your blood moving and muscle mass heated up. Begin with some light cardio workouts like jogging in position or jumping jacks. This will increase your heart price and prepare your body for the upcoming training session.

Next off, visit this web-site on vibrant stretching to enhance versatility and series of activity. Carry out activities like leg swings, arm circles, and torso twists. Dynamic extending helps to activate your muscles and avoids them from getting stressed during training. Keep in mind to hold each go for just a couple of seconds and prevent bouncing, as this can bring about muscle mass tears or stress.

Appropriate Strategy and Form



After warming up and extending, it's necessary to concentrate on proper method and form in order to prevent injuries throughout fighting styles training.

Taking notice of your strategy and type can make a significant distinction in decreasing the threat of injury. Below are five key points to remember:

- Preserve a solid and steady position, distributing your weight uniformly.
- Keep your core engaged and your body lined up to guarantee proper balance and security.
- Implement strategies with precision and control, preventing unnecessary stress on your muscular tissues and joints.
- Concentrate on proper breathing strategies to enhance endurance and avoid muscle tension.
- Listen to your body and avoid pressing past your restrictions, slowly raising strength and difficulty gradually.

Recuperation and Rest Techniques



Taking ample time for recuperation and rest is important in preserving a healthy and injury-free martial arts training regular. After extreme training sessions, your body needs time to repair and recuperate. It's during this duration that your muscle mass rebuild and enhance, allowing you to improve your efficiency gradually.

Make sure to incorporate day of rest right into your training routine to provide your body the time it needs to heal. Additionally, focus on getting sufficient rest each evening as it plays a vital function in recuperation. Sleep is when your body repair services harmed tissues and releases development hormones.

Appropriate nourishment is also vital for healing. Ensure to sustain your body with a well balanced diet that includes sufficient protein to sustain muscle mass fixing and carbohydrates to renew power stores.
